The term computed tomography, or ct, refers to a computerized xray imaging procedure in which a narrow beam of xrays is aimed at a patient and quickly rotated around the body, producing signals that are processed by the machines computer to generate crosssectional imagesor slicesof the body. Metal objects implanted in the bodies of patients usually generate severe streaking artifacts in reconstructed images of x ray computed tomography, which degrade the image quality and affect the diagnosis of disease. Computed tomography ct was the first noninvasive radiological method allowing the generation of tomographic images of every part of the human body without superimposition of adjacent structures. Xray microtomography, like tomography and xray computed tomography, uses xrays to create crosssections of a physical object that can be used to recreate a virtual model without destroying the original object.
